Kyle Anthony Clark is convicted for voting from the Pima County Jail

A Pima County jury found Kyle Anthony Clark guilty of illegal voting, and the court sentenced him to 3.5 years in the Arizona Department of Corrections. The Arizona Attorney General disposition log says Clark voted in the 2020 general election while he was an inmate at the Pima County Jail and his rights had not been restored after felony convictions. The Arizona Court of Appeals later affirmed Clark's conviction and sentence. The case put one jail-voting prosecution through a jury verdict and an appeal, creating a stronger record than an allegation alone.
